Digital Marketing in the Post-Search Era: What Comes After Google?

For decades, Google has been the centerpiece of digital marketing — from SEO strategies to paid search campaigns. But as we enter a new era of digital behavior in 2025, a major shift is underway: people are no longer relying on search alone to find what they want. Instead, they’re engaging with content through AI assistants, social discovery, voice interfaces, and closed ecosystems like TikTok, Instagram, and ChatGPT-like platforms.

So what does digital marketing look like after Google?


🔍 The Decline of Traditional Search Behavior

People now ask questions directly in AI tools or get product recommendations via influencers and curated feeds, bypassing the classic search engine entirely.

  • Gen Z increasingly uses TikTok as a search engine.
  • Voice search and AI assistants are answering queries without surfacing traditional web links.
  • Platforms like Amazon, YouTube, and Pinterest are dominating vertical search (shopping, video, visual ideas).

Takeaway: Search is no longer the only (or even primary) gateway to discovery.


🧠 Rise of Intent-Driven AI Assistants

With tools like ChatGPT, Perplexity AI, and Google’s own Gemini, users are expecting smart, contextual answers — not just links. These AI models aggregate data, summarize results, and deliver single-response solutions.

For brands, this means:

  • Optimizing for AI visibility (clear, structured, high-authority content).
  • Leveraging first-party data and schema markup to be included in model training.
  • Creating content that answers, not just ranks.

📱 Searchless Discovery: Social is the New Search

On plat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ts:

  • Users are passively discovering content through algorithmic curation.
  • Brands win by joining conversations instead of waiting to be searched.
  • Influencers act as navigators, guiding purchasing decisions without any search involved.

Tip: Focus on storytelling and native content optimized for short-form video and social SEO (hashtags, sound trends, captions).


🎯 The New Funnel: From Discovery to Loyalty Without Search

In the post-search landscape, the funnel starts with discovery in-feed, moves to direct engagement or messaging, and ends with repeat connection (via email, app, or social DM).

To thrive, marketers must:

  • Prioritize channel cohesion and cross-platform brand voice.
  • Build creator partnerships that embed their message authentically.
  • Leverage DM automation, micro-sites, and email personalization to close the loop.

What Should You Do Now?

To future-proof your digital strategy:

  1. Reevaluate your dependence on Google-centric tactics
    Diversify your acquisition beyond SEO/PPC.
  2. Double down on high-quality content that answers user needs
    Think about how your content would sound if read aloud by an AI assistant.
  3. Invest in discovery-first channels
    Create compelling social videos, carousels, and reels that spark engagement.
  4. Build community around your brand
    Email lists, private groups, and exclusive content matter more than ever.
  5. Get familiar with AI tools and content surfacing mechanics
    Being AI-visible is the next evolution of being Google-searchable.

🌐 Final Thoughts: A Searchless Future is Still a Connected One

Google isn’t going away entirely — but it’s no longer the only game in town. As digital habits evolve, marketers must think beyond keywords and rankings.

Success in the post-search era means meeting your audience where they are, not where they used to be.
